Strategy Maps

A strategy map shows how the objectives that have been defined for a scorecard and the KPIs that measure their progress are aligned by perspectives. It also indicates cause and effect relationships between objectives and other objectives or KPIs with connecting lines. You create cause and effect relationships when you create (or edit) an objective (see "Creating an Objective") or work with KPI details (see "Working with KPI Details"). You also can create cause and effect relationships in a strategy map.

You can create multiple strategy maps to represent the strategy of different areas of your organization.

You can create strategy maps in Edit mode only. For more information about the Edit and View modes, see "Scorecard Editor Edit and View Modes.
